Duran Duran discography

Summary

English new wave band Duran Duran have released 16 studio albums, four live albums, four compilation albums, two remix albums, two box sets, seven extended plays, 46 singles and 14 video albums. Duran Duran have sold over 100 million records.[1] The band have achieved UK top-five albums in five consecutive decades (1980s to 2020s), and US top-10 albums in three decades (1980s, 1990s and 2010s).

Videography edit

Video albums edit

List of video albums
Year Title Additional notes
1983 Duran Duran Video compilation
1984 Duran Duran Video 45 Video EP featuring "Girls on Film" and "Hungry Like the Wolf"
Dancing on the Valentine Video compilation
As the Lights Go Down Slightly different version of Arena film. Initially only shown on Cinemax and MTV, released to the consumer market first with the 2010 reissue of Seven and the Ragged Tiger.
Sing Blue Silver Documentary; released on DVD in 2004
1985 Arena (An Absurd Notion) Concert film; released on DVD in 2004
The Making of Arena Documentary; released on DVD in 2004
1987 Three to Get Ready Black-and-white documentary
* Short version – 29 minutes
* Long version ("Collector's Edition") – 75 minutes
1988 Working for the Skin Trade Concert film
6ix by 3hree Video compilation
1989 Decade Video compilation. 1995 UK version adds videos of "Violence of Summer", "Serious", "Ordinary World" and "Come Undone"
1993 Extraordinary World Documentary and video compilation
1998 Greatest Video compilation; reissued on DVD in 2003
2005 Live from London Concert at Wembley Arena
2008 Classic Albums: Rio 2008 documentary on the making of Rio.
2009 Live at Hammersmith '82! 1982 Rio Tour concert at London's Hammersmith Odeon. Released as a CD/DVD package, the DVD also includes bonus tracks including the promo video of "My Own Way" which had never been released on DVD.
2012 A Diamond in the Mind: Live 2011 2011 All You Need Is Now Tour concert at Manchester's MEN Arena. Includes bonus features of two additional songs as well as a behind the scenes documentary including interviews with band members.
